**New Starter Checklist — Item 6: Badge Migration (Project Keybridge)**

During the migration from the old Lanward badge system, new starters at Fenholt Place will not receive a permanent badge on day one. Team assistants should walk the starter to their floor and show them the keypad entry by the kitchen door. Have them enter the interim code below.

staff pass of haweg-bafop = bdg-G-69

Welcome, plugin authors. As Thornbury migrates scheduled cron jobs into the Quellrun workflow engine, each plugin must declare its triggers explicitly rather than relying on crontab entries. During migration week, legacy jobs stay read-only. To access the sandbox migration vault and test your declarations safely, authenticate with the recovery passphrase provided below.

unlock words, kagef-taduf: fenir-quenix-norwyn-sorvan-gormir-gorir-fraok

**Meeting notes — Harrowby API sync, excerpt**

- N+1 confirmed on `orders { customer { region } }` path; one query per order row.
- Fix: batch loader keyed by customer ID, request-scoped cache. Deployed to staging.
- Benchmarks: 480 queries down to 3 on sample workload.
- Contractors: do not add new resolvers without a loader; see the loader guide in the repo.
- Remaining: add regression test asserting query count.
- Rollout to production pending final review by the engineer named below.

account owner for kafop-haweg: Pelax Gilael Istir

## Quillhopper Autoscaler Environments

The autoscaler watches queue depth on the ingest topics and scales workers accordingly — nothing fancy, but the thresholds differ per environment, which trips people up in review. Staging scales aggressively on purpose so we can catch oscillation bugs early; prod is more conservative. If a PR touches scaling math, sanity-check it against both. Staging currently runs with the following values.

config for kafof-bawef:
holath:
  log_level: debug
  metrics_host: metrics.holath.qorvelsys.internal
  pin: 2191
  pool_size: 32